Filtered Hearing Protection Devices Market Share and Trends Analysis

The global filtered hearing protection devices market size is valued at US$ 866.9 million in 2025 and is projected to reach US$ 1,554.4 million growing at a CAGR of 8.7% during the forecast period from 2025 to 2032.

The filtered hearing protection devices market is a crucial segment within the broader realm of hearing protection technologies, aimed at addressing conditions affecting an individual’s hearing ability in a noise-intensive environment. Filtered hearing protection devices are a type of personal protective equipment (PPE) designed to protect the wearer's ears from harmful noise while still allowing them to hear essential sounds, such as speech and warning signals.

The devices use filters or electronic components to reduce the intensity of loud noises while maintaining clear communication and situational awareness. They are commonly used in environments where hearing protection is necessary, such as industrial settings, construction sites, and shooting ranges, to prevent noise-induced hearing loss while allowing wearers to remain aware of their surroundings.

Market Dynamics

Driver - Rising Industrialization and Infrastructural Developments

The field of hearing protection has experienced remarkable growth and product specialization, reflecting a notable demand-side market trend in the filtered hearing protection devices market. This specialization is characterized by advancements in filter technology, design, materials, and features such as Bluetooth connectivity and digital signal processing (DSP).

Rising industrialization and infrastructure development contributes to the growing demand for filtered hearing protection technologies such as active protection earmuffs. Noise levels from machinery, equipment, and construction activities rise with industrialization, increasing the need to wear hearing protection devices.

Governments and regulatory agencies impose strict occupational safety standards as industrialization advances. To protect workers from noise-induced hearing loss (NIHL), these regulations frequently require the use of hearing protection devices. In industrial areas, the need for filtered hearing protection devices is driven by compliance with these laws.

Furthermore, rising demand for custom-fit earplugs that offer a personalized fit ensuring optimal comfort and effectiveness for user spending extended periods in noisy environments such as traffic or on highways, having comfortable and effective hearing protection is crucial for long-term health and safety. All these factors are expected to drive the global market for filtered hearing protection devices over the forecast period.

Restraints - Global Market Variance, and Regulatory Compliance

Different regions may have varying regulations, cultural attitudes, and market demands pertaining to the filtered hearing protection devices. Compliance with safety regulations and standards could pose challenges for manufacturers and distributors. Ensuring that products meet all necessary requirements adds complexity to the production and distribution processes.

High-quality filtered hearing protection devices can be more expensive than traditional foam earplugs or earmuffs. Further, finding the right fit and level of comfort for extended periods may be a challenging factor. Cost-conscious consumers may opt for cheaper alternatives, potentially hindering market growth.

Additionally, communicating the effectiveness of filtered hearing protection devices in terms of Noise Reduction Ratings (NRR) can be complex for consumers to understand. Clear and accurate labelling and marketing are essential to convey the level of protection provided.

Category-wise Analysis

By Product Insights

Filtered earplugs are specialized ear protection devices designed to reduce the intensity of loud noises while maintaining clarity for speech and other essential sounds. Unlike traditional hearing protection devices that block all sounds, filtered earplugs use advanced technology to attenuate harmful noise levels while allowing safe levels of sound to pass through.

Availability of custom-molded earplugs, high-fidelity earplugs, and other solutions across various platforms, while maintaining uniform attenuation in earplugs specially for the users in the music industry, and motorsports category, have led many key players to employ synergistic approaches for the distribution and manufacturing of these products through various market strategies.

Regional Insights

North America Filtered Hearing Protection Devices Market Analysis

North America has a diverse industrial landscape including heavy manufacturing, construction, entertainment, and military sectors. All these sectors contribute significantly towards creating a demand for filtered hearing protection devices across various applications.

Further, North America has a very well-developed healthcare infrastructure facilitating easier access to hearing healthcare services including hearing protection consultation and customized hearing protection fittings. Moreover, stringent regulatory requirements regarding workplace safety in North America, require industries to provide hearing protection devices by law to employees who are exposed to loud noise levels.

All these factors together with presence of leading manufacturers and higher awareness regarding NIHL among consumers, contribute to North America’s leading position in the global filtered hearing protection devices market.
